Custom Installation Service

Closed
Call
28150 Avenue Crocker Ste 210
Valencia, CA 91355

Custom Installation Service is a company based in Valencia, CA that specializes in providing custom installation services.

They offer a range of installation solutions for both residential and commercial clients, tailored to meet individual needs and preferences.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esCaliforniaValenciaCustom Installation Service

Partial Data by Foursquare.